Аннотация:The abilities of methods of statistical analysis are demonstrated based on the example of the studyof present-day bottom sediments of the western part of the Barents Sea. As a result of cluster and dispersive analyses, the principles of distribution of granulometric types of the present-day bottom sediments and concentrations of organic carbon in them have been identified along the depth within the sublittoral and bathyal sea zones. It is concluded on the basis of our results that the granulometric distribution of sediments is caused by mechanical differentiation of sedimentary material via its transportation by marine currents, as well as the distance from the main provenances: Novaya Zemlya, Kola Peninsula, and Spitsbergen. The accumulation of organic carbon in bottom sediments was related to the peculiarities of the distribution of communities of marine organisms within these facies zones. The high content of organic carbon in the bathyal zone of the sea was related to the increase in primary productivity, as well as the transportation of marine currents of accumulated biogenic material in the littoral and sublittoral zones toward the bathyal zone.Keywords: bottom sediments of the Barents Sea, facies of the Barents Sea, dispersive analysis, cluster analysis, granulometric types of sediments, western part of the Barents Sea
